Has the tire casing been cut or just the rubber? Is there exposed tube popping out? If the casing is intact, I'd just fill it with some superglue and replace after the race. If the casing is damaged, replace it before riding again

YES, replace it! While I do agree with most of the recommended temp fixes noted, it is probably best/safest to replace it. In addition to the cut, there seems to be some bulge to the left. So that means there may have been some internal casing damage. If this is your front tire, absolutely replace it as you do not want a flat while riding (highly dangerous handling). If this is your back tire, it is just a pain-in-the-rear replacing a tube/tire. Safe riding.
